I got me a woman, fine as can be,
Drives men crazy but she loves only me,
She gives me money, I'm high on the hog
And all I gotta do is walk her old dog
Now all my jealous friends wanna know
Is she the one?

Her brothers a lawyer, mom's an MD
Dad fixes cars, they take care of me
She's good to my mother, loves all my kids
Even the one that's out on the skids
Now all my crazy relatives are buggin me
Is she the one?

The preacher called me and the elks did too
They wanna know what I'm gonna do
The social reporter from the local rag
She's blowing smoke and that's a serious drag
Now people I don't know are taking it for fact
That she's the one

I love my baby like a good man should
But settling down I don't know if I could
I asked the man above and he said aloud
If you don't want her send her up to my cloud
Now what's a man to do when even God has decreed
That she's the one

Thanks to all for the kind words. I'm glad folks liked the harp solo. TJ Klay is a world class player but I have always found his RTs hard to use. It took about 25 renders and a fair amount of cutting and pasting to get this one to work. And it's still not like anything he would play in real life. But I'm happy with it and sure wish my own playing had his intonation and timing. Glad everyone enjoyed the lyrics, especially since the only parts I usually supply are melody and words. I will play some harp, a little guitar and maybe even sing (hold your ears) on some future tracks. Especially since fiverr vox are not free by any means.
